
Kerala dams fill up as rains boost hydel prospects; Idukki storage crosses 43 pc
With catchment areas still receiving rain, state’s immediate priority is to closely monitor inflows, storage, and control releases at reservoirs approaching operational limits
Water levels in Kerala’s major hydel reservoirs have risen sharply following sustained monsoon rains, improving the state’s power-generation prospects even as the continuing inflow keeps the dam management system under close watch.
The latest Kerala State Electricity Board Limited (KSEB) figures show that Idukki, Kerala’s largest hydel reservoir, is holding 43.47 per cent of its live storage capacity, with 634.45 million cubic metres (MCM) of water as of 11 am on August 4.
Storage up by 11 percentage points
The improvement comes after three consecutive days of heavy inflow into the reservoirs. Over the three days, the overall storage in KSEB reservoirs increased by around 11 percentage points. Although rainfall intensity in the catchment areas has eased slightly, water levels are not expected to fall immediately because inflows from upstream areas are likely to remain substantial.

The sustained inflow is particularly significant for Kerala’s power sector. Higher reservoir storage provides KSEB with greater flexibility to operate its hydel stations and generate electricity, potentially reducing the pressure to rely on more expensive power purchases from outside the state. The availability of water also gives the utility greater room to manage generation through the remaining monsoon months.
Water levels improve in key reservoirs
The latest figures show that several of the state’s major reservoirs are now carrying substantial storage. Kakki-Anathode in Pathanamthitta has reached 50.51 per cent of its storage capacity, with live storage of 226 MCM, while Pamba stands at 43.15 per cent and Moozhiyar at 45.60 per cent. In Idukki district, besides the main Idukki reservoir at 43.47 per cent, Ponmudi has recorded 62 per cent storage, while Anayirankal is at 24.98 per cent, Kundala at 30.85 per cent, and Kallar at 26.96 per cent.
The Idamalayar reservoir in Ernakulam is at 48.85 per cent of its total storage capacity, while Sholayar in Thrissur has 48.43 per cent storage. Banasurasagar in Wayanad has the highest storage among the major reservoirs listed in the latest bulletin – at 58.08 per cent.

The situation marks a significant improvement from the position a little over a week ago. The combined storage in KSEB’s major reservoirs stood at around 30 per cent on July 25, equivalent to 1,225.7 million units (MU). By August 2, it had climbed to 43 per cent, or 1,762.33 MU. Though this remained below the storage recorded on the same date in 2024 and 2025, it was higher than the corresponding level in 2023.
Highest single-day inflow in 5 years
The intensity of the inflow is also noteworthy. KSEB reservoirs recorded their highest single-day inflow in five years on Sunday (August 2), with inflow equivalent to around 147.599 million units of electricity. Such inflows can rapidly alter reservoir levels, particularly when heavy rainfall is concentrated in the catchment areas of power projects.
The latest KSEB bulletin also indicates that there are currently no warnings for the major reservoirs listed in the August 4 update. This represents a change from the situation on August 3, when six reservoirs were under alert conditions.

The August 3 alert bulletin had placed Moozhiyar, Kallarkutty, Erattayar, Lower Periyar, Poringalkuthu and Kuttiyadi under various stages of warning. Lower Periyar had reached 100 per cent of its live storage at full reservoir level, while Kallarkutty was at 98.48 per cent and Kuttiyadi at 96.86 per cent. Poringalkuthu was at 56.93 per cent, with a spillway release of 177.08 cubic metres per second. The situation underlines how quickly reservoir conditions can change during an intense spell of monsoon rainfall.
Opportunity and challenge
For KSEB, the rise in storage is both an opportunity and a management challenge. Greater water availability means increased potential for hydel generation, but the utility has to balance generation requirements with reservoir safety and downstream flows. If heavy rainfall continues, controlled releases may become necessary at reservoirs approaching their operational limits.
For consumers, the improved storage position could provide some relief on the power front. Hydel generation is a relatively important component of Kerala’s electricity mix, and better water availability allows KSEB to maximise generation from its own stations when operational conditions permit.
The immediate concern, however, is not a shortage of water but the pace of inflow. With catchment areas still receiving rain, reservoir levels could remain elevated even after rainfall intensity has marginally declined. KSEB will therefore have to closely monitor inflows, storage and spillway conditions while simultaneously making the best use of the additional water for power generation.

For now, the latest figures point to a clear turnaround: Kerala’s reservoirs have moved from water scarcity concerns to a position where abundant inflows are strengthening the state’s hydel generation potential, while keeping dam management firmly at the centre of the monsoon response.
Red Alert issued
The India Meteorological Department (IMD) has issued a Red Alert for Kerala, warning of very heavy rainfall at isolated places. However, the department has clarified that the alert does not indicate a likelihood of “extremely heavy rainfall”. The Red Alert has been issued considering the forecast of very heavy rain as well as the cumulative impact of rainfall received across the state in recent days.
According to the IMD, a cyclonic circulation is currently situated over southern Karnataka and adjoining areas at an altitude of around 5.8 km above mean sea level. Another cyclonic circulation is located over the central-western Bay of Bengal and adjoining coastal Andhra Pradesh, extending up to around 4.5 km altitude.
Kerala is expected to receive light to moderate rainfall from August 4 to 8, with isolated heavy rainfall likely during the period. The weather department has also warned of strong winds and rough weather along the Kerala-Lakshadweep coast. On August 4, 5 and 6, winds are expected to reach 40–50 kmph, gusting up to 60 kmph at times.
